Wegovy is a once-weekly injectable medication that belongs to a class of drugs called GLP-1 receptor agonists. These medications were originally developed to help manage blood sugar in people with type 2 diabetes, but researchers later discovered their strong effect on appetite regulation and weight reduction.Wegovy works by mimicking a natural hormone in the body that helps control hunger and food intake. As a result, individuals tend to feel full sooner, eat smaller portions, and experience fewer cravings throughout the day.For beginners, this mechanism may feel unfamiliar at first, especially since it directly influences appetite and digestion. However, when used correctly under medical guidance, it is designed to support gradual and steady weight loss rather than rapid or extreme changes.
Wegovy primarily targets areas of the brain that regulate appetite and food satisfaction. When injected, it slows down how quickly food leaves the stomach, which helps increase feelings of fullness after meals. This means people may naturally reduce calorie intake without feeling constantly hungry.Another important effect is its influence on blood sugar regulation. Although it is not primarily a diabetes medication in this context, it still helps stabilize glucose levels, which can reduce energy crashes and cravings for sugary foods.For beginners, this combination of reduced appetite and improved satiety can feel like a major lifestyle shift. It is important to understand that the medication works gradually, and results are typically seen over weeks or months rather than days.
For most beginners, Wegovy is considered safe when prescribed appropriately and used under proper medical supervision. However, like any prescription medication, it is not free from side effects or risks.The safety profile of Wegovy has been studied extensively in clinical research. Most individuals tolerate it well, especially when starting with a low dose and gradually increasing it over time. This step-by-step approach is specifically designed to help the body adjust and minimize discomfort.That said, beginners may experience some mild to moderate side effects during the initial phase. These can include nausea, bloating, fatigue, or mild digestive changes. In most cases, these symptoms improve as the body adapts to the medication.

While Wegovy can be helpful for many individuals, it is not suitable for everyone. Beginners should be especially aware of certain health conditions that may require caution.People with a history of severe gastrointestinal disease, certain thyroid conditions, or allergic reactions to similar medications may need alternative options. It is also not recommended for pregnant or breastfeeding individuals.Additionally, those who have a history of pancreatitis or gallbladder issues should be carefully evaluated before starting treatment.Safety in beginners is highly dependent on individual health history, so proper assessment before starting is essential.

1. What is Wegovy used for?
Wegovy is primarily used for weight management in individuals who are overweight or obese. It helps regulate appetite and reduce calorie intake when combined with lifestyle changes.
2. How long before results show?
Some people notice early changes within a few weeks, but noticeable weight loss typically develops over several months of consistent use.
3. Can beginners stop Wegovy suddenly?
It is not recommended to stop suddenly without medical advice. Discontinuation should be discussed with a healthcare provider to avoid unwanted changes in appetite or weight.
4. What are the most common side effects?
The most common side effects include nausea, reduced appetite, digestive discomfort, and mild fatigue. These usually improve over time.
5. Is Wegovy safe for long-term use?
Studies suggest it can be used long-term under medical supervision, but ongoing monitoring is important to ensure continued safety and effectiveness.
6. Do lifestyle changes still matter while using Wegovy?
Yes, lifestyle changes remain essential. A balanced diet and regular physical activity significantly improve results and support long-term weight management.
